Alan Dershowitz is one of the most celebrated and debated legal minds in American history, having served for fifty years as a professor at Harvard Law School. A lifelong civil libertarian and staunch defender of free speech, he has argued hundreds of appeals in courts throughout the nation. His unique position as a liberal who has represented controversial clients across the political spectrum gives him a rare and unflinching perspective on the dangers of silencing dissent, which he confronts directly in this book.
